We're partnering with a well-established Brisbane organisation seeking an experienced HR Advisor to join their team on an eight‑month maternity leave contract. This is a role that offers variety, meaningful work and the opportunity to contribute across a range of people initiatives, projects and operational HR activities. More importantly, it's an prospect to join a team that values collaboration, strong relationships and supporting one another to deliver great outcomes. What stood out to us wasn't the position description. It was the culture. The team are looking for someone who enjoys partnering with people, takes a practical approach to problem solving and understands that building trust and influencing change often comes down to patience, credibility and strong relationships.

Opportunity

Working closely with the HR team, you'll play a key role in supporting a range of people initiatives and day-to-day operations across the business, including:

- Recruitment and onboarding
- Payroll preparation and coordination
- Performance review and KPI processes
- HR administration and reporting
- Policy and procedure reviews
- Learning and development initiatives
- Employee engagement activities
- Process improvement projects
- General HR advisory support

You'll also have the chance to contribute to several projects already underway,



with scope to build on your existing strengths and gain exposure to new areas of HR.

About You

You will be someone who enjoys working in a relationship-driven environment and brings a balanced mix of technical HR capability and strong interpersonal skills.

You'll likely bring

- Experience operating at HR Advisor level
- Strong stakeholder engagement and relationship‑building skills
- A collaborative and team‑oriented approach
- High levels of emotional intelligence and adaptability
- Solid organisational skills and attention to detail
- The ability to manage competing priorities and changing demands
- A genuine interest in continuous improvement and finding better ways of working

Experience with SAP or a similar HRIS platform and payroll process will be highly regarded, though not essential.
